编程智慧物流软件代码是什么
-
编程智慧物流软件的代码可以分为不同的模块,包括以下几个关键部分:
-
数据库管理模块:该模块用于管理物流信息的存储和检索。它负责创建和维护物流数据库,并提供必要的接口来操作数据库中的数据,如货物信息、仓库信息、运输信息等。
-
用户管理模块:该模块用于管理用户的注册、登录和权限控制。它提供用户注册、登录、修改密码等功能,并根据用户的身份和权限对用户进行身份验证和访问控制。
-
路线规划模块:该模块用于根据货物的起点和终点,计算最佳的运输路线。它可以使用一些算法和策略来确定最短路径或者最优路径,以提高运输效率和降低成本。
-
运输调度模块:该模块用于调度运输车辆和管理货物的运输过程。它根据货物的机密和优先级,将货物分配给最合适的运输车辆,并实时监控货物的运输进程,以确保货物按时安全到达目的地。
-
费用计算模块:该模块用于计算货物运输所需的费用。它根据货物的重量、距离、运输方式等因素,计算出相应的运输费用,并提供费用报表和统计功能。
-
数据分析模块:该模块用于对物流数据进行分析和统计。它可以根据不同的指标和查询条件,对物流数据进行统计分析,生成报表和图表,帮助用户进行决策和优化物流运作。
以上是智慧物流软件编程中常见的一些关键模块,当然根据具体的需求和项目要求,还可以进一步开发其他功能和模块。编写智慧物流软件的代码需要使用合适的编程语言和开发框架,如Java、Python、C#等,并结合适当的数据库技术和开发工具进行开发和测试。
1年前 -
-
编写智慧物流软件的代码可以分为以下几个方面:
-
基础代码:包括数据结构的定义和数据库的建立。智慧物流软件需要存储、管理和处理大量的数据,因此首先需要设计合适的数据结构来存储这些数据。同时,需要建立数据库来存储和管理这些数据,并且开发相应的数据库连接代码。
-
用户界面代码:智慧物流软件需要提供用户友好的界面,以便用户能够方便地操作和查看相关信息。用户界面的设计需要考虑到各种不同的设备和屏幕尺寸,因此需要编写响应式设计的代码,并且使用合适的前端框架来实现界面的布局和交互。
-
物流管理代码:智慧物流软件的核心功能是管理物流信息,包括货物的跟踪、仓库的管理、配送路线的规划等。这部分代码需要实现物流业务的逻辑,比如货物的状态更新、订单的分配、配送路线的优化等。同时,还需要考虑到不同物流场景的需求,比如国内物流和国际物流的差异。
-
运输调度代码:智慧物流软件需要实现运输调度的功能,包括车辆的调度和路径的规划。这部分代码需要根据物流需求和车辆资源,动态地进行调度和路径规划,以提高运输效率和降低成本。常用的算法包括最短路径算法、最优化算法等。
-
数据分析和预测代码:智慧物流软件还可以利用大数据分析和机器学习技术,对物流数据进行分析和预测。这部分代码需要实现数据的清洗、特征提取、模型训练等步骤,以提供更精确的物流分析和预测结果。常用的算法包括聚类分析、回归分析、决策树等。
以上只是智慧物流软件开发中的一些基本代码方面。具体的代码实现将根据具体的需求和技术选型而有所差异。编写智慧物流软件的代码需要综合运用多种编程语言和技术,比如Java、Python、C++、数据库管理、前端开发等,以实现软件的各项功能。
1年前 -
-
编程智慧物流软件的代码是指实现智慧物流软件功能的计算机程序代码。下面将从方法、操作流程等方面讲解智慧物流软件的代码。
代码编写方法:
- 确定需求:首先确定智慧物流软件的功能需求,包括货物管理、运输管理、配送管理等。
- 设计数据模型:根据需求设计数据模型,包括货物、订单、运输车辆、司机等。
- 编写代码:根据数据模型设计,使用合适的编程语言进行代码编写,例如Java、Python、C#等。
- 测试与调试:编写代码后进行测试和调试,确保代码可以正常运行并满足需求。
- 优化与维护:根据用户反馈和需求变更进行代码优化和维护,保持软件的稳定运行和功能完善。
操作流程:
-
货物管理:
a. 登录系统:用户使用用户名和密码登录系统。
b. 创建货物:用户输入货物信息,包括名称、重量、体积等,并生成唯一的货物编号。
c. 更新货物信息:用户可以根据需求修改已创建货物的信息。
d. 删除货物:用户可以根据需求删除已创建的货物。
e. 查询货物:用户可以根据货物编号、名称等条件查询货物的相关信息。 -
订单管理:
a. 创建订单:用户输入订单信息,包括收货人、收货地址、货物信息等,并生成唯一的订单编号。
b. 更新订单信息:用户可以根据需求修改已创建订单的信息。
c. 删除订单:用户可以根据需求删除已创建的订单。
d. 查询订单:用户可以根据订单编号、收货人等条件查询订单的相关信息。 -
运输管理:
a. 创建运输任务:用户输入运输任务信息,包括出发地、目的地、货物信息等,并生成唯一的任务编号。
b. 分配司机和车辆:根据任务要求,系统自动分配合适的司机和车辆进行运输。
c. 更新任务信息:用户可以根据需求修改已创建的运输任务信息。
d. 查询任务:用户可以根据任务编号、出发地等条件查询运输任务的相关信息。 -
配送管理:
a. 创建配送计划:用户输入配送计划信息,包括配送日期、订单信息等,并生成唯一的计划编号。
b. 分配配送员:根据计划要求,系统自动分配合适的配送员进行配送。
c. 更新计划信息:用户可以根据需求修改已创建的配送计划信息。
d. 查询计划:用户可以根据计划编号、配送日期等条件查询配送计划的相关信息。
以上是智慧物流软件的主要功能模块和操作流程,根据实际需求可以进一步扩展和细化代码编写。
1年前